Image Component Library (ICL)
icl::qt::DefineRectanglesMouseHandler Member List

This is the complete list of members for icl::qt::DefineRectanglesMouseHandler, including all inherited members.

addRect(const utils::Rect &rect)icl::qt::DefineRectanglesMouseHandler
bringToBack(int idx)icl::qt::DefineRectanglesMouseHandler
bringToFront(int idx)icl::qt::DefineRectanglesMouseHandler
Callback typedeficl::qt::DefineRectanglesMouseHandlerprivate
callbacksicl::qt::DefineRectanglesMouseHandlerprivate
callCallbacks()icl::qt::DefineRectanglesMouseHandlerprivate
clearAllRects()icl::qt::DefineRectanglesMouseHandler
clearRectAt(int x, int y, bool all=false)icl::qt::DefineRectanglesMouseHandler
currBeginicl::qt::DefineRectanglesMouseHandlerprotected
currCurricl::qt::DefineRectanglesMouseHandlerprotected
DefineRectanglesMouseHandler(int maxRects=10, int minDim=4)icl::qt::DefineRectanglesMouseHandler
draggedRecticl::qt::DefineRectanglesMouseHandlerprotected
getAllRectsAt(int x, int y) consticl::qt::DefineRectanglesMouseHandler
getMaxRects() consticl::qt::DefineRectanglesMouseHandler
getMetaData(int index) consticl::qt::DefineRectanglesMouseHandler
getMetaDataAt(int x, int y) consticl::qt::DefineRectanglesMouseHandler
getMinDim() consticl::qt::DefineRectanglesMouseHandler
getMutex() consticl::utils::Lockableinlineprotected
getNumRects() consticl::qt::DefineRectanglesMouseHandler
getOptions()icl::qt::DefineRectanglesMouseHandler
getOptions() consticl::qt::DefineRectanglesMouseHandler
getRectAt(int x, int y) consticl::qt::DefineRectanglesMouseHandler
getRectAtIndex(int index) consticl::qt::DefineRectanglesMouseHandler
getRects() consticl::qt::DefineRectanglesMouseHandler
handleEvent(const MouseEvent &event)icl::qt::MouseHandlerslot
lock() consticl::utils::Lockableinlineprotected
Lockable(bool recursive=false)icl::utils::Lockableinlineprotected
Lockable(const Lockable &l)icl::utils::Lockableinlineprotected
maxRectsicl::qt::DefineRectanglesMouseHandlerprotected
minDimicl::qt::DefineRectanglesMouseHandlerprotected
mouse_handler typedeficl::qt::MouseHandler
MouseHandler(mouse_handler handler)icl::qt::MouseHandlerinlineexplicit
MouseHandler()icl::qt::MouseHandlerinlineprotected
operator=(const Lockable &l)icl::utils::Lockableinlineprotected
optionsicl::qt::DefineRectanglesMouseHandlerprotected
process(const MouseEvent &e)icl::qt::DefineRectanglesMouseHandlervirtual
rectsicl::qt::DefineRectanglesMouseHandlerprotected
registerCallback(const std::string &id, Callback cb)icl::qt::DefineRectanglesMouseHandler
setMaxRects(int maxRects)icl::qt::DefineRectanglesMouseHandler
setMetaData(int index, const utils::Any &data)icl::qt::DefineRectanglesMouseHandler
setMetaDataAt(int x, int y, const utils::Any &data)icl::qt::DefineRectanglesMouseHandler
setMinDim(int minDim)icl::qt::DefineRectanglesMouseHandler
unlock() consticl::utils::Lockableinlineprotected
unregisterCallback(const std::string &id)icl::qt::DefineRectanglesMouseHandler
visualize(ICLDrawWidget &w)icl::qt::DefineRectanglesMouseHandler
~Lockable()icl::utils::Lockableinlineprotected